Web Development: A Strategic Guide to Building Digital Excellence

In the modern digital landscape, web development is the backbone of any successful business strategy. It encompasses the entire process of creating, building, and maintaining an online presence that is not only visually appealing but also functionally robust. Whether you are a startup founder looking to launch your first platform or an enterprise leader upgrading legacy systems, understanding the breadth of web development is essential for aligning your digital assets with your long-term business goals.

At https://divine-by-design.com, we believe that effective development goes beyond writing lines of code; it is about creating meaningful interactions between users and your brand. By prioritizing clean architecture, intuitive user interfaces, and high-performance backends, organizations can transform their web presence into a powerful growth engine that drives engagement and streamlines operations.

Understanding the Core Pillars of Web Development

Web development is generally split into three primary domains: frontend, backend, and full-stack development. The frontend represents the « client-side, » where users interact directly with buttons, layouts, and animations. This area focuses heavily on responsive design, accessibility, and ensuring a seamless experience across mobile and desktop devices. A well-executed frontend uses modern frameworks to ensure that the site loads quickly and provides a consistent interface regardless of the hardware being used.

The backend, or « server-side, » is the engine room of any application. It handles the logic, database interactions, authentication, and API integrations that make functionality possible. Developing a secure backend is critical, as this is where sensitive user data is stored and processed. When these two sides work in tandem—orchestrated effectively through APIs and microservices—businesses can achieve high levels of scalability and performance for their digital platforms.

Key Features and Capabilities for Modern Web Projects

When planning a web development project, it is important to identify the essential features that will define your user experience and operational efficiency. Modern web solutions should prioritize load speed, cross-browser compatibility, and secure data handling. Features like content management systems (CMS) allow teams to update information without needing to touch code, while integrated analytics dashboards provide real-time visibility into user behavior and engagement metrics.

Furthermore, automation and workflow management have become standard components for complex web applications. Many businesses today require seamless integration with third-party tools such as payment gateways, CRM systems, or marketing automation platforms. These integrations reduce manual data entry, minimize human error, and allow your team to focus on strategic growth initiatives rather than repetitive administrative tasks.

Scalability and Reliability in Infrastructure

For any growing enterprise, the reliability of a web application is non-negotiable. Scalability refers to the ability of your web architecture to handle increased traffic and data loads without a degradation in performance. Choosing the right cloud architecture—whether it is serverless, containerized, or traditional VPS hosting—is a foundational decision that impacts the long-term viability of your site. A robust design ensures that you can scale resources up or down based on seasonal demand or business growth cycles.

Reliability, on the other hand, is built through regular monitoring, proactive maintenance, and rigorous security protocols. Downtime can lead to significant revenue loss and damage to brand reputation. Therefore, development practices must include automated testing suites, continuous integration/continuous deployment (CI/CD) pipelines, and disaster recovery planning. By prioritizing these structural elements, you ensure that your platform remains a stable cornerstone for your digital operations.

Security Principles for Future-Proof Development

Security is not a one-time check but an ongoing process that starts from the first line of code. As cyber threats become more sophisticated, web development must incorporate « security-by-design » principles. This includes implementing data encryption (SSL/TLS), secure authentication protocols such as OAuth, and regular vulnerability scanning to identify potential entry points for attackers. Keeping software dependencies updated is another crucial aspect of maintaining a secure environment.

Businesses must also ensure compliance with industry-specific data protection regulations like GDPR or CCPA. Managing user consent, securing API endpoints, and implementing role-based access control are standard requirements for any professional web solution. When development addresses security from the beginning, you protect not only your own intellectual property but also the trust you have built with your customers.

Comparing Approaches: Custom Development vs. Off-the-Shelf Tools

One of the most significant decisions a business makes is whether to build a custom solution or utilize existing platforms. This decision should be based on your specific use cases, budget, and future requirements. Custom development offers complete control over the feature set and branding, but it requires a larger initial time investment. Off-the-shelf tools, conversely, offer rapid deployment but may limit your ability to differentiate or add highly specialized functionality later on.

Factor Custom Development Off-the-Shelf Solutions
Flexibility High (Completely tailored) Moderate (Rigid structure)
Setup Time Longer (Requires planning) Fast (Ready to use)
Maintenance Requires internal/hired team Managed by vendor
Ownership Full control Limited by user agreement

Essential Workflow Elements for Success

Successful web development projects rely on clear communication and a structured workflow. The lifecycle typically begins with discovery, where business needs are analyzed and technical requirements are defined. Following this, the design phase sets the visual standard, which is quickly followed by iterative development cycles. At each stage, stakeholder feedback is vital to ensure that the final result aligns with the original vision.

  • Discovery & Strategy: Aligning project goals with technical possibilities.
  • Design & Prototyping: Visualizing the user journey and interface.
  • Development & Integration: Building the core logic and connecting services.
  • Testing & QA: Ensuring the platform works flawlessly across devices.
  • Deployment & Monitoring: Launching and ongoing performance management.

Choosing the Right Support and Technology Partner

The success of your digital project often comes down to the quality of the technical partnership you build. Whether you are managing an internal team or outsourcing to an agency, ensure that your partners have a track record of reliability and a deep understanding of your business needs. Look for teams that emphasize transparent reporting, regular updates, and clear documentation. A good partner will act as a consultant, helping you navigate the trade-offs between speed, cost, and technical debt.

Ultimately, investing in quality web development is an investment in the longevity of your business. By focusing on sustainable practices, security, and a user-first mindset, you can build a digital presence that stands the test of time. As technology continues to evolve, stay focused on building modular, scalable solutions that can evolve alongside your business objectives, ensuring you remain competitive in an increasingly digital world.